On 12/22/23 18:19, Sam Varshavchik wrote:
Is there for a way that a package's %build or %install script can generate additional Provides: and Requires: dependencies?

Doing some digging, I found the (relatively) recently developed dynamic buildrequires, and %generate_buildrequires.

What I'm looking to do is something analogous, but have %build or a %install generate additional dependencies to supplement Requires:, Provides:, and the automatically-generated dependencies.

I suppose I can override %__find_requires and %__find_provides, and have that run my own script first, then the default ones.

You want this:

